网页版IM如何支持多语言环境?
随着互联网的普及,即时通讯(IM)工具已经成为人们日常生活中不可或缺的一部分。而随着全球化的发展,网页版IM如何支持多语言环境,成为了一个亟待解决的问题。本文将从以下几个方面探讨网页版IM如何支持多语言环境。
一、多语言环境的必要性
- 满足不同地区用户的需求
随着全球化的推进,越来越多的人使用互联网进行交流。不同地区的人们使用不同的语言,为了满足这些用户的需求,网页版IM必须支持多语言环境。
- 提高用户体验
在多语言环境下,用户可以方便地使用自己的母语进行交流,这有助于提高用户体验,降低沟通障碍。
- 增强竞争力
在竞争激烈的IM市场中,支持多语言环境可以吸引更多用户,提高产品的竞争力。
二、实现多语言环境的途径
- 翻译
(1)人工翻译:聘请专业的翻译人员进行翻译,确保翻译质量。但这种方式成本较高,且难以满足快速迭代的需求。
(2)机器翻译:利用机器翻译技术,如谷歌翻译、百度翻译等,实现快速翻译。但机器翻译存在一定的误差,需要人工校对。
- 国际化设计
(1)界面设计:采用国际化设计,如使用通用的图标、符号等,降低语言障碍。
(2)语言自适应:根据用户的语言偏好,自动切换界面语言。
- 技术支持
(1)国际化框架:使用国际化框架,如i18n(国际化)、l10n(本地化)等,简化多语言环境的实现。
(2)多语言资源管理:采用资源文件管理多语言内容,方便更新和维护。
三、多语言环境的挑战与应对策略
- 挑战
(1)翻译成本高:人工翻译成本较高,机器翻译存在误差。
(2)维护难度大:多语言环境需要不断更新和维护,以保证翻译质量。
(3)技术实现复杂:国际化框架和资源文件管理等技术实现较为复杂。
- 应对策略
(1)合理分配翻译资源:针对不同语言,合理分配翻译资源,提高翻译效率。
(2)引入机器翻译与人工校对相结合:利用机器翻译提高翻译速度,人工校对确保翻译质量。
(3)简化国际化框架:采用成熟的国际化框架,降低技术实现难度。
(4)建立多语言资源管理机制:采用资源文件管理多语言内容,简化更新和维护。
四、总结
网页版IM支持多语言环境是满足全球化需求的重要举措。通过翻译、国际化设计、技术支持等途径,可以解决多语言环境带来的挑战。在未来的发展中,网页版IM应不断优化多语言环境,提高用户体验,增强竞争力。
猜你喜欢:IM即时通讯